About PINEAPPLE PEPPER CHUTNEY
PINEAPPLE PEPPER CHUTNEY is a moderate-calorie food with 167 calories per 100-gram serving. Its primary macronutrient source is carbohydrates, providing 0g of protein, 38.9g of carbohydrates, and 0g of fat. This food belongs to the Pickles, Olives, Peppers & Relishes category.
Ingredients
PINEAPPLE, SUGAR, HONEY, WATER, RED BELL PEPPERS, DISTILLED VINEGAR, JALAPENO PEPPERS, TOMATO PASTE, CORN STARCH, DEHYDRATED ONIONS, SPICE, SALT.
